Mother And Child Car Driver Killed By Falling Tree Due To Strong Winds Hit Bengkulu
Illustration of fallen trees due to heavy rain followed by strong winds. (Between)

Strong winds hit the area of Lake Dendam Tak Sudah in Bengkulu. As a result, a fallen tree hit a car containing a mother and child who died instantly. "Indeed, two people died who were AM's mother (23) and a SM child due to being hit by a tree in the Lake Dendam area Never," said Secretary of the Bengkulu Province BPBD Khristian Hermansyah in Bengkulu City, Tuesday, May 9, confiscated by Antara. He said that one other victim, namely IR, was receiving treatment at the Bengkulu City DKT Hospital. The incident began when the vehicle used by the three victims from the intersection of the Bengkulu City Mobile Brigade intersection and when they arrived in the Lake Dendam area, the tree collapsed due to strong winds that occurred. Previously, the Meteorology, Climatology and Geophysics Agency (BMKG) was a strong wind extreme station in the Bengkulu Province area which reached 35 knots. In addition, strong winds that occurred in a number of areas in Bengkulu Province were also accompanied by rain with moderate to very heavy intensity. "Today there was strong winds accompanied by rain with moderate to heavy intensity," said the Head of the BMKG Data and Information Section of the Baai Bengkulu Island Climatology Station, Anang Anwar in Bengkulu City.
